Pressure Laundering Wood Surfaces



When pressure washing wood surfaces, it's critical to choose the appropriate equipment and strategy to prevent damage. Beginning by choosing a stress washing machine with adjustable settings. A reduced stress, typically between 1,200 to 1,500 PSI, is suitable for wood. This assists protect against gouging or removing the wood fibers.

Prior to you begin, make certain to clear the area of furniture, plants, and other barriers. It's necessary to evaluate a tiny, unnoticeable section initially to guarantee your method and stress setups won't damage the surface.

Use a follower nozzle attachment for an even distribution of water. Hold the nozzle at a 45-degree angle and at least 12 inches far from the timber to decrease the threat of damages.

As you wash, relocate long, sweeping motions along the grain of the timber. This strategy aids raise dirt and particles effectively without leaving touches.

After cleaning, rinse the surface thoroughly to eliminate any type of remaining cleaning solution. Allow the timber to completely dry totally before using any sealant or stain. Complying with these actions will guarantee your wood surfaces continue to be in terrific condition while looking fresh and clean.

Strategies for Cleansing Concrete



Concrete surface areas can build up dust, crud, and spots over time, making efficient cleaning methods vital. To begin, you'll wish to utilize a stress washer with a minimum of 3000 PSI for concrete cleansing. This level of pressure efficiently eliminates stubborn stains without harming the surface area.

Before you start, spray the area with a concrete cleaner or a mix of cleaning agent and water. Allow it to dwell for regarding 10-15 mins; this assists break down difficult stains.

Next, attach a wide spray nozzle to your stress washing machine, preferably a 25-degree or 40-degree pointer. This will distribute the water equally and lessen the risk of etching.



When you start stress cleaning, work in sections. Maintain the nozzle concerning 12 inches from the surface and preserve a constant, sweeping motion. This strategy guarantees you do not miss out on any places or use too much stress in one area.

For particularly persistent stains, you may need to repeat the procedure or use a more concentrated cleaner.

Lastly, rinse the area completely after cleaning. This action prevents any deposit from continuing to be on the concrete, leaving it clean and looking fresh.

Best Practices for Plastic Exterior Siding



Vinyl exterior siding is a popular option for home owners because of its toughness and reduced maintenance demands. Nonetheless, to keep it looking its ideal, you'll require to press wash it occasionally.

Begin by preparing the location-- remove any furnishings, plants, or challenges near your home. Next, pick a pressure washer with a nozzle that supplies a wide spray; commonly, a 25-degree nozzle works well.

Before you start, evaluate a tiny section to guarantee your setups won't damage the house siding. Maintain the pressure listed below 2000 PSI to avoid any type of dents or splits. Begin with the bottom and work your method up, cleaning in sections to prevent streaks.

Use a cleaning agent specifically formulated for vinyl home siding to assist eliminate dirt and mold. Use it with your pressure washer or a pump sprayer, allowing it to sit for around 10 mins.
